About Debra L. Karch

Debra L. Karch is a scholar working on Health, Clinical Psychology and Infectious Diseases, having authored 27 papers that have together received 1.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Homicide, Infanticide, and Child Abuse (11 papers), Suicide and Self-Harm Studies (11 papers) and Gun Ownership and Violence Research (10 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Health (404 citations), Clinical Psychology (668 citations) and Emergency Medicine (139 citations). Debra L. Karch has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Israel. Frequent co-authors include Nimesh Patel, Keri M. Lubell, Joseph E. Logan, Holly A. Hill, Linda L. Dahlberg, Alex E. Crosby, LaVonne Ortega, Lawrence Barker, Tara W. Strine and Dawn McDaniel. Their work appears in journals such as American Journal of Epidemiology, American Journal of Public Health and International Journal of Environmental Research and Public Health.
